WebCeruloplasmin (or caeruloplasmin) is a ferroxidase enzyme that in humans is encoded by the CP gene.. Ceruloplasmin is the major copper-carrying protein in the blood, and in addition plays a role in iron metabolism.It was first described in 1948. WebCeruloplasmin is a positive acute-phase reactant and a copper-binding protein that accounts for over 95% of serum copper in normal adults. Ceruloplasmin is measured primarily to assist with a diagnosis of Wilson disease. Other indications include Menkes disease, dietary copper insufficiency, and risk of cardiovascular disease.
